Noise-driven amplification mechanisms governing the emergence of coherent extreme events in excitable systems

The physics governing the formation of extreme coherent events, i.e., the systemwide emergence of an observable taking extraordinary values in a short time window, is a relevant yet elusive problem to a variety of disciplines ranging from climate science to neuroscience.
